Sharp E-Series LCD TVs

Sharp has a new range of LCD TVs for the masses, this time courtesy of the E-Series. The models won’t come in eye-popping large sizes though, targeting cramped and petite rooms that more and more people have to deal with as cities get overpopulated. The LC-20E5 and LC-16ES measure 20″ and 16″ respectively, with both of them sharing the following :-

  • 1,366 × 768 resolution
  • 450 cd/m2 brightness
  • Contrast ratio of 1,200:1
  • Viewing angle of 178 degrees
  • Dual TV tuners (analog and digital)
  • Ethernet jack
  • Automatic brightness adjusting sensor

Both models will hit retail stores in Japan by September 10th onwards, with the 16″ and 20″ models going for $850 and $950, respectively.
